Lieutenant Colonel ARTHUR DENIS BRADFORD COCKS

Service Number: 31536
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Royal Engineers

5 Assault Regt.

Date of Death

Died 06 June 1944

Age 39 years old

Buried or commemorated at

FRIMLEY (ST. PETER) CHURCHYARD

Grave 239.

United Kingdom

Frimley (St Peter) Churchyard

Photographer: Andrew Fetherston

  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of George Arthur Cocks, C.B.E., C.I.E., and Annie Violet Cocks; husband of Marjorie Du Caurroy Cocks, of Camberley.
  • Personal Inscription KILLED IN THE ASSAULT ON NORMANDY
